Sidney Crosby Passes Mario Lemieux to Become Penguins’ All-Time Points Leader

A first-period goal plus an assist lifted him to 1,724 points, placing him eighth on the NHL’s all-time list.

Overview

  • Crosby tied the record by tipping an Erik Karlsson shot, then set it up on a power play when his blast produced a rebound finished by Rickard Rakell.
  • The Penguins beat the Canadiens 4-3 in a shootout, snapping an eight-game winless stretch as Rakell netted the deciding attempt.
  • Postgame totals credited Crosby with 645 goals and 1,079 assists in 1,387 games, giving him the franchise points lead at 1,724.
  • A video message from Lemieux congratulating Crosby played at PPG Paints Arena, drawing a standing ovation as teammates celebrated on the ice.
  • Next milestones loom with Crosby 31 points from tying Steve Yzerman for seventh on the NHL list and 45 goals shy of Lemieux’s Penguins goal record of 690.
